If anonymous users aren't allowed to start meetings and all authenticated participants have left the meeting, the meeting ends 90 minutes after the last authenticated participant left. If anonymous users are allowed to start meetings, the meeting ends after four hours. The meeting ends if there are no changes to the attendee list after 24 hours.Īll of the users are dialed in to the meeting but someone has used a PIN to enter the meeting.Īll of the users are dialed in to the meeting but there wasn't anyone who used a PIN to enter the meeting. Users have joined using the Skype for Business or Microsoft Teams app or have dialed in to the meeting. The maximum length of time depends on who is in the meeting and the type of authentication they used to join the meeting. What is the maximum length of the Audio Conferencing meetings? If a meeting attendee uses a different number that is included in the invite, it will be a shared phone number. Local dial-in numbers, and also in some cases international dial-in numbers from the country where your organization is located, will be included on the meeting invite. So, Skype for Business or Microsoft Teams meetings scheduled by User A and another User B will both have the same dial-in number. ![]() The phone assigned to your organization and that number is shared by the users within that organization that are enabled for Audio Conferencing. These local numbers will be only available to your organization. The dial-in numbers will be included in the meeting invite. There are local dial-in numbers that are assigned to you when you purchase the licenses for Audio Conferencing. How many local dial-in numbers are currently supported?
